Tribeca Retreat is a minimalist apartment located in New York, New York, designed by Monomid. The design concept draws inspiration from the enduring appeal of mid-century modern design while smoothly integrating industrial architectural details. The objective was to find a sweet spot between warmth and sophistication, offering a stylish and cozy space. The client’s vision was clear—create a cozy oasis in the heart of the bustling city without sacrificing chic aesthetics. They specifically requested the incorporation of mid-century modern elements, harmoniously merging them with the apartment’s existing industrial features.

At the heart of the living space sits the luxurious Arflex Marenco sofa, draped in dark charcoal upholstery. It dominates the room, enveloping you in comfort. Complementing this plush centerpiece is the carefully selected &Tradition Boomerang Lounge Chair. Strategically positioned, it introduces a structural element that balances the softness of the sofa. Together, they strike a perfect equilibrium where comfort meets clean lines, a hallmark of mid-century modern design. In the dining area, the Arflex marble dining table takes center stage. Its sleek surface, adorned with subtle veins, exudes sophistication and luxury. This marble masterpiece bridges the cozy living space with the sleek lines of mid-century modern design.

Around this opulent table, you’ll find the Karakter Principal Dining Chairs. Upholstered in rich leather with wooden accents, they elevate the dining experience. The combination of leather and wood adds a touch of warmth to the area, enhancing both comfort and the overall aesthetic. In the living room, the Mod 265 wall lamp by Paolo Rizzatto takes center stage. This swing arm lamp is a masterpiece of mid-century-inspired design, providing both style and function. Moving to the dining room, the Model 2065 pendant by Gino Sarfatti is an elegant presence. It doesn’t just illuminate; it’s a statement piece that hovers gracefully above the Arflex marble dining table.
